A cost-effective handling solution for Asian terminals
Visitors were particularly interested in the Terex® QuaymateTM M50 mobile harbour cranewhich has been specifically designed for cost-effective handling of containers, bulk materials, general and project cargo. Introduced to the marketplace last year, it is tailored to the needs of small maritime and river ports.The efficient diesel-electric machine wasnamed Crane of the Year in November 2014 by the “International Bulk Journal” (IBJ).The Quaymate M50 was specially developed for Asian markets and combines components of Asian and European origin. It offers a maximum load capacity of 50 t, a working radius of up to 36 m and a maximum lifting speedof 50 m/min. With optional equipment enabling use of external power sources in the terminal,emission-free crane operation is possible.
Manufactured in Xiamen, the Quaymate M50 mobile harbour crane is responding to the needs of the East and South-East Asian markets.
Ideal replacement for outdated, non-specific equipment
The Quaymate M50 makes it possible to cost-effectively replace non-port machines, such as conventional telescopic, truck-mounted and stationary cranes and excavators, with dedicated equipment for professional handling of all cargo types. Maurizio Altieri, General Manager of the TPS facility in Xiamen, explains: “In Asia particularly, many terminals are still working with outdated equipment, which is not designed for continuous handling in a rough maritime environment. We are now offering these terminals an economical, functional, service-friendly and robust crane that will help them with continuous loading and unloading of inland ships and coasters.”Based on the Terex®Gottwald design philosophy, the QuaymateM50 is a genuine mobile harbour crane, designed to suit a limited investment budget. According to Altieri, “The crane offers terminal operators economic working speeds, short delivery lead times and a service life appropriate to the area of application.”

Versatileofferfrom Terex
In addition to the QuaymateM50 mobile harbour crane, TPS presenteditsTerex®FDC 280 and FDC 320 forklift trucks. These versatile machines with a maximum lifting capacity of 28 t and 32 t respectively are now also manufactured in the TPS Xiamen factoryin order to better respond to the specific requirements of Chinese customers. They are used for a wide range of general cargo such as steel coil and pallets; with a spreader they can also handle containers. About Terex Port Solutions
Terex Port Solutions is part of the Material Handling & Port Solutions business segment of Terex Corporation that supplies customers in ports with a unique combination of machines, software and services under the Terex and Terex Gottwald brands. Whether it is ship-to-shore cranes, reach stackers or fully automated, integrated handling systems for containers and bulk, Terex Port Solutions provides reliable solutions for rapid, safe, efficient handling of all forms of cargo with low downtimes and excellent return on investment.
